Infrastructure
In today's digital age, a robust infrastructure is not merely an asset but a prerequisite for any platform aiming to provide consistent and uninterrupted service. At the heart of our commitment to offering real-time financial data to small and medium-sized enterprises lies a carefully engineered infrastructure. It serves as the backbone, ensuring data accuracy, timely delivery, and system availability. Understanding the criticality of financial data for our clientele, we have designed our infrastructure to be resilient against disruptions, adaptable to increasing demands, and efficient in data processing and delivery. This documentation provides an in-depth overview of the technical aspects that constitute our system's foundation.
Distributed Architecture
Overview
Utilizing a distributed architecture allows our platform to minimize latency while enhancing overall system reliability. This approach divides the system into smaller components or nodes that operate independently, ensuring data remains accessible even if one or more nodes face disruptions.
Benefits
- Scalability: Nodes can be added or removed without affecting the entire system.
- Redundancy: Multiple nodes ensure there's no single point of failure.
- Latency Reduction: Data requests are managed by the nearest node, ensuring faster data retrieval.
Platform Engine
Overview
Though the specific details of our platform engine remain internal, it's important to note that it has been engineered to manage substantial data loads. Designed for high-availability and performance, the engine can handle concurrent data streams efficiently.
Core Features
- High Throughput: Efficiently processes large amounts of incoming data.
- Optimized Data Handling: Uses advanced algorithms to streamline data aggregation and distribution.
Data Aggregation and Network
Data Sources
We integrate data from a variety of global sources, ensuring a comprehensive data set. This includes real-time financial metrics from currencies, cryptocurrencies, indices, stocks, and futures.
High-Performance Network
Our network infrastructure is optimized for speed and efficiency, ensuring that data transmission from global sources to our platform, and subsequently to end-users, is swift and seamless.
[Animated Diagram: This section will visually represent the flow of data from sources to our engine and then to end-users.]
Monitoring and Alert Systems
Overview
Continuous monitoring tools are integrated into the infrastructure to track system health and performance. These tools ensure the system runs optimally and help in early detection of potential issues.
Key Components
- Real-time Alerts: Immediate notifications for any discrepancies or failures.
- Diagnostics: Quick identification of problem areas for timely resolutions.
- Performance Metrics: Continuous tracking of system performance to ensure adherence to expected benchmarks.
Infrastructure is the underlying strength of our platform, ensuring that our users can access reliable and real-time financial data whenever they need it.